Wood window services involve a range of repairs, restorations, and replacements designed to maintain or improve the appearance, functionality, and energy efficiency of wooden windows. These services typically include fixing broken or rotting wood, replacing damaged panes, restoring old frames, and sealing gaps to prevent drafts. Skilled contractors can also handle tasks such as sanding, repainting, and weatherproofing to extend the lifespan of existing wood windows. Homeowners seeking to preserve the classic charm of their property or improve energy efficiency often turn to these services to enhance their windows' performance and appearance.

Many common problems can be addressed through wood window services. Over time, wood frames may develop rot, cracks, or warping due to exposure to moisture and temperature fluctuations. Windows that do not open or close smoothly can pose security risks and hinder ventilation. Additionally, gaps around the window frame can lead to drafts, increasing heating and cooling costs. Restoring or replacing damaged components can prevent further deterioration, improve insulation, and restore the window’s original aesthetic. These services are especially useful when windows become difficult to operate or show signs of aging that compromise their function.

The overview below groups typical Wood Window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Amsterdam, NY.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for routine repairs like replacing broken glass or weatherstripping usually range from $250 to $600. Many projects fall within this middle range, depending on the scope of work and window size.

Partial Restoration - Restoring or refinishing existing wood windows generally costs between $800 and $2,500 per window. Larger, more detailed restoration projects can reach $3,500+ but are less common.

Full Replacement - Installing new wood windows typically costs from $1,200 to $4,000 per window, with many projects landing in the middle of that range. Larger or custom-sized windows may push costs higher.

Complex or Custom Projects - Larger, more complex jobs such as custom designs or historic preservation can exceed $5,000 per window. These projects are less frequent but are handled by local contractors for specialized needs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of wood are commonly used for window frames? Local contractors often work with a variety of woods such as pine, oak, cedar, and mahogany to match different styles and durability needs.

Can wood windows be customized to fit existing openings? Yes, local service providers can customize and install wood windows to ensure a precise fit for existing or new openings.

What are the benefits of choosing wood windows over other materials? Wood windows offer natural aesthetics, excellent insulation properties, and the ability to be stained or painted to match interior and exterior decor.

How do I maintain the appearance of wood windows? Regular painting, staining, and sealing by local contractors can help preserve the look and functionality of wood windows over time.

Are there different styles of wood windows available? Yes, local service providers can install various styles such as double-hung, casement, awning, and picture windows to suit different preferences.
